Solar Street Light with Integrated MPPT Charger Reference Design

Overview

TopologyOther Topology
Input voltage15-22 V
Output 10.7 A

Description

This design is a 12A Maximum Power Point Tracking (MPPT) solar charge controller with a 700mA LED driver. It is targeted for low power solar charger and LED driver solutions such as solar street lights. This design is capable of charging 12V batteries with up to 10A output current from 12V panels. However, it can be easily adapted to 24V systems by just changing the MOSFETs to 60V rated parts. Also, the design can drive up to 15 LEDs in series with 700mA of current. It is possible to adapt the design for LED currents up to 1.1A with minimum change in hardware. TI provides a complete solar inverting system for low power loads. Additionally this design takes real world considerations in to account, such as reverse battery protection, built-in battery charge profile for 12V Pb-acid batteries, and a highly efficient design.
